HGRC visiting fellow Dr Anastasia Dukova gave a public talk at the Queensland State Archives on 14 July 2017.  Anastasia spoke on the  key aspects of town life and policing of today’s Brisbane in its transition years, from the arrival of the first immigrant ships in the Moreton Bay settlement in the 1840s, to the establishment of Brisbane as a colonial capital in 1859.
